Spurs display ambitious objectives at the dawn of the NBA 2025-2026 season. However, a name is noted by his absence in the roster of Mitch Johnson. What to penalize Victor Wembanyama and his teammates?
Voilà 6 seasons that the Spurs no longer played NBA playoffs. An eternity for one of the most dominant franchises from the beginning of the 21st century. After years to tank and chain the disillusions, San Antonio finally seems cut to cross a course.

Bookmakers even make Victor Wembanyama one of the favorites for the MVP title. A fairly crazy prognosis, which does not detract from the fact that the French can carry its franchise to the playoffs. However, the pivot will not succeed. His association with De’Aaron Fox could make sparks.
At his side, Wembanyama will also have to count on young talents of Spurs. The NBA 2025 draft made it possible to recover Carter Bryant and Dylan Harper, both candidates for a place in the Johnson roster. Stephon Castle’s sophomore season will also be observed closely.

Another name could also prove to be decisive in the conquest of Spurs. Man in the shadow of Gregg Popovich since 2021, Matt Nielsen allowed Mitch Johnson to take the reindeer of the Spurs without the slightest hitch. Unfortunately, No public information confirms that Nielsen will remain in office for the NBA 2025-2026 season.
What worry the young players of the Spurs, who absolutely bet on the coach assistant to progress. Matt Nielsen was notably appointed as responsible No. 1 to help Stephon Castle during his first steps in the NBA. When you know how much the rear of San Antonio shone in its first season, we understand why Matt Nielsen is essential on the Spurs bench.
Several American journalists specializing in the news of the Texan franchise say, however, that the assistant coach of Johnson will be in office next season, despite several major changes.
